BBNC's Mission, Vision, Values & Strategic Directions

(Approved by the Board of Directors on March 24, 2011.  Launched on June 8, 2011.)


Our Mission

Birchmount Bluffs Neighbourhood Centre works with diverse individuals, families and communities to overcome barriers and enhance quality of life.  We do this by fostering social inclusion, developing skills and abilities, and collaborating with our partners to facilitate access to a range of flexible and responsive programs and services.


Our Vision

We envision a strong and inclusive neighbourhood in which community members fully participate in opportunities that enhance well-being for all.


Our Values

We define these values as follows:

  • Respect: We believe that every person has the right to be met with compassion, accepted in a non-judgmental way, and treated with respect and dignity.
  • Diversity: We embrace diversity in all of its forms, in our clients, agency and community, and support non-discriminatory policies and practices.
  • Inclusivity: We actively seek ways to welcome all members of our community and ensure they have the opportunity to participate in meaningful ways.
  • Building Capacity: We nurture the development of individual and community capacity by offering programs and services that enhance independence and build upon abilities.
  • Equitable Access: We commit to removing barriers that restrict individuals and groups from accessing services and participating in our programs.
  • Collaboration: We believe that each of us is enriched when we are able to work collaboratively with one another to share experiences, perspectives, information, knowledge and supports.
  • Integrity: We employ honesty and ethical decision-making practices in all that we do.
  • Accountability: We recognize that our community has entrusted us with an important responsibility, so we take care to be responsible and accountable for the management of our agency within available resources.

Our Strategic Directions (Next 3 Years)

  1. Focus on organizational responses that enhance our capacity to deliver accessible and responsive services
    • Conduct a community needs assessment
    • Work in collaboration with strategic partners
    • Address access barriers
    • Review and update current programs
    • Develop targeted outreach/communication plans
  2. Strengthen our internal infrastructure to ensure service excellence
    • Support board development, recruitment and succession planning
    • Develop core competencies in our board, staff and volunteers
    • Improve planning, communication and coordination across programs
    • Update and implement key operational policies and practices
    • Monitor our progress towards shared goals
    • Pursue viable space options that enable program expansion
  3. Engage and empower our community to address issues that impact their lives
    • Consult with our participants (current and potential)
    • Mobilize community assets and abilities
    • Expand capacity building and leadership development efforts
    • Create new connections
